Transaction 3d9aed725bd55bfbe8763624f2de71142044203b86154611d669036f143cb658
1 Input
1 Output
-
3d9aed725bd55bfbe8763624f2de71142044203b86154611d669036f143cb658:0
- value
- 1273244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f6abe088d4726ae7d9c675fd00ccabec68ba768 OP_EQUAL
- address
- 3K98rmbKZ8tCk45PUVVhy9vU6q9F6CM4Go